The Data Engineer is responsible for designing, building, and maintaining
scalable, reliable, and high-performance data pipelines and platforms
. This role enables analytics, reporting, and data science by ensuring data is
accurate, timely, and accessible
across the organization.
Key ResponsibilitiesData Pipeline & Platform Development
Design, develop, and maintain
ETL/ELT pipelines
for structured and semi-structured data.
Build and optimize
batch and real-time data ingestion
pipelines.
Ensure data pipelines are
scalable, resilient, and fault-tolerant
.
Data Modeling & Storage
Design and manage
data models, data marts, and data warehouses/lakes
.
Optimize data storage for performance, cost, and analytics use cases.
Implement data partitioning, indexing, and lifecycle management strategies.
Data Quality, Governance & Security
Implement
data quality checks, validation rules, and monitoring
.
Ensure data pipelines comply with
data governance, security, and regulatory standards
.
Manage metadata, lineage, and documentation.
Collaboration & Support
Work closely with
data analysts, BI developers, data scientists, and business teams
.
Support analytics and reporting use cases by providing clean and reliable datasets.
Troubleshoot data issues and perform root cause analysis.
DevOps & Automation
Automate data workflows using
CI/CD pipelines
.
Monitor pipeline performance and implement proactive alerting.
Improve operational efficiency through automation and tooling.
Technical Skills (Mandatory)
Data lakes & formats: Parquet, Delta Lake, Iceberg
Containerization & orchestration: Docker, Kubernetes
Experience in
banking, finance, or regulated environments
Knowledge of data privacy and compliance standards
Soft Skills
Strong analytical and problem-solving skills
Ability to work independently and in cross-functional teams
Good communication and documentation skills
Ownership mindset and attention to detail
Deliverables
Scalable data pipelines
Curated analytics-ready datasets
Data models and documentation
Monitoring and alerting dashboards
Job Type: Contract
Contract length: 12 months
Pay: RM4,472.94 - RM13,298.60 per month
Benefits:
Health insurance
Maternity leave
Opportunities for promotion
Parental leave
Professional development
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.